Index: mojo/service_manager/service_manager_unittest.cc |
diff --git a/mojo/service_manager/service_manager_unittest.cc b/mojo/service_manager/service_manager_unittest.cc |
index 429b707936a9cf21273b8c157d32998bb7c61033..77ffab9d21e714aa42eac563ee1bc7dc1e373f3f 100644 |
--- a/mojo/service_manager/service_manager_unittest.cc |
+++ b/mojo/service_manager/service_manager_unittest.cc |
@@ -150,19 +150,15 @@ class TestApp : public Application, public ServiceLoader { |
BindServiceProvider(service_provider_handle.Pass()); |
} |
- virtual void ConnectToService(const mojo::String& service_url, |
- const mojo::String& service_name, |
- ScopedMessagePipeHandle client_handle, |
- const mojo::String& requestor_url) |
+ virtual bool AllowIncomingConnection(const mojo::String& service_name, |
+ const mojo::String& requestor_url) |
MOJO_OVERRIDE { |
if (requestor_url_.empty() || requestor_url_ == requestor_url) { |
++num_connects_; |
- Application::ConnectToService(service_url, |
- service_name, |
- client_handle.Pass(), |
- requestor_url); |
+ return true; |
} else { |
base::MessageLoop::current()->Quit(); |
+ return false; |
} |
} |